At Ferriby Station, simplicity is key. While there is no traditional ticket office, travelers can easily purchase and collect their tickets from on-site machines. The station ensures accessibility with induction loops and accessible ticket machines on Platform 1. Though minimalistic, Ferriby offers the essentials for your journey, but be prepared as there are no toilets, seating areas, or refreshment facilities at the station. If you need assistance, rest assured that help is just a call away at 08002006060, providing you with both information and support for a seamless journey.

While at Ferriby Station, connectivity isn’t limited to trains alone. Rail replacement services offer convenient pick-up and drop-off at nearby bus stops on New Walk, ensuring you don't miss a connection. If taxis are more your style, head over to north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you to arrange a ride. For bus travelers, a short walk leads you to local services with handy stops near the station. Sadly, bike hire is not an option here, but there's secure bicycle storage available for those making the journey on wheels.

For those purchasing tickets at Bloxwich North, it's important to note that there isn't a ticket office. However, convenient ticket machines are available where you can collect prepaid tickets without hassle. Accessibility features are somewhat limited. There is step-free access, which includes longer ramps. The station lacks some amenities, such as waiting rooms and toilets, which might be something to keep in mind for longer waits. Despite these limitations, the station does feature CCTV to enhance security and ensure passenger safety.
Transport links to and from Bloxwich North are adequate for most commuters. For instance, the station provides a rail replacement service operating from Cresswell Crescent, near the junction with Tintern Crescent. If you prefer taxis, numbers for local taxi services are conveniently available, making it easy to book a ride to your next destination. Additionally, there are printable formats of bus journey information provided, ensuring you have all you need for your onward journey.
